Transaction 33fa9cc6539bd0e58c2607f26086e7b7701bc260db7cbc604870e0647099798d
1 Input
1 Output
-
33fa9cc6539bd0e58c2607f26086e7b7701bc260db7cbc604870e0647099798d:0
- value
- 30941960
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dd0088764af4ee138267d1fdbdd117e3addb5b8
- address
- bc1q8hgq3pmy4a8wzwpx050ahhg30cadmddcc0kmuu